Pizza Hut Dough Recipe

Prep Time 15 minutes
Resting Time 45 minutes
Servings: 1 large pizza
Calories: 70

Ingredients
  

  • 1 1/3 cup water
  • 2 tsp sugar
  • 1 1/4 tsp salt
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 tbsp cornmeal
  • 2 cups unbleached all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up bread fl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 174 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p onion powder
  • 3/8 tsp msg
  • 1 1/2 tsp dry yeast (add 174 tsp more for breadier dough)

Equipment

  • Food processor or dough hook (or it can be done by hand)

Method
 

If Using a Food Processor
  1. Place the water, sugar, salt, and olive oil in the bowl of the food processor and pulse to dissolve the sugar and salt. Add yeast, bread flour, all-purpose flour, and all of the other dry ingredients. Process until a soft ball forms. Remove the dough from the machine and allow it to rest covered with a tea towel for about 45 minutes.
If Using a Dough Hook and Mixer
  1. Place the water, sugar, salt, and olive oil in the bowl of the mixer and dissolve the sugar and salt. Stir in the yeast, bread flour, all-purpose flour, and all of the other dry ingredients. Knead with the dough hook to form a soft, but not-too sticky dough (about 8 minutes). Remove the dough from the machine and allow it to rest covered with a tea towel for about 45 minutes.
If Preparing by Hand
  1. Place the water, sugar, salt, and olive oil in a bowl and dissolve the sugar and salt. Stir in the yeast, all-purpose flour, and all of the other dry ingredients. Knead to form a soft, but not-too sticky dough (about 8-l0 minutes). Allow the dough to rest, covered with a tea towel for about 45 minutes.

Notes

  • It may take longer than 10 minutes to knead the dough, especially if you're doing it by hand. The important thing to remember is that the semi-sticky consistency of the dough is what you're aiming for.
